Breidis Prescott

72″ reach · +1.44% reach advantage · 32nd percentile

Breidis Prescott has a reach of 72″ against a height of 71″ — a reach advantage of +1.44%, short for welterweight boxing and the 32nd percentile of the 130 compared here.

How this is worked out

  1. Measurements and records are read from the fighter's English Wikipedia infobox; the fight list is parsed from the article's own results table.
  2. Reach advantage is (reach − height) ÷ height as a percentage, so fighters of different sizes compare directly.
  3. Percentiles rank this fighter among the 130 welterweight boxing fighters in the dataset — chosen because it is the most specific group of at least 30 that this fighter belongs to.
Reach advantage = (reach − height) ÷ height × 100
